Abstract

The present invention provides a startup sequence control method of fuel cell-super capacitor hybrid electric vehicles, which can protect a fuel cell at the time of the starting of the fuel cell, reduce the start-up time and promote convenience of a driver in a fuel cell-super capacitor serial hybrid system which does not employ a high-voltage power converter. The startup sequence control method comprises the steps of: determining whether or not a low-voltage auxiliary battery is in a state where its voltage is less than a reference voltage or in a cold start condition after a key-on signal has been input; if the auxiliary battery is in the state where its voltage is less than a reference voltage or in the cold start condition, matching the voltage of a main bus terminal to the voltage of an auxiliary power source through the voltage boost of a power converter; turning on a relay for cutting off the voltage of the auxiliary power source and a main relay of a precharge unit for the auxiliary power source; and turning off the power converter and then driving a fuel cell auxiliary component using the auxiliary power source to thereby boost a fuel cell voltage.
